A lower tower and better public space is coming to Marble Arch

Wednesday, 6 July, 2016
​Roadworks are under way at Marble Arch to enable the rebuilding of the tower to a new design which will be lower in height than the existing building. The work will create some temporary delays around the area, which WCC and TfL have tried to keep to a minimum.
